Unveiling Biases in AI: The SHADES Initiative's Impact on Language Models
SHADES is a groundbreaking dataset created by Hugging Face's Margaret Mitchell and her team to tackle cultural biases and harmful stereotypes in large language models globally. It evaluates biases across 16 languages and 37 regions, promoting ethical AI practices.

Star Birth Struggles Under Magnetic Forces: New Insights from the Webb Telescope
The James Webb Space Telescope has provided groundbreaking insights into the challenges of star formation at the Milky Way's core, revealing how magnetic fields may impede stellar birth in the Sagittarius C region.
